Registrations open for Dawn to Dusk Chennai Marathon to be held on Oct 5

CHENNAI: The 8th edition of the Dawn to Dusk (D2D) Chennai Marathon will be held on October 5 at Anna University. Registrations for the event, organised by the Neville Endeavours Foundation (NEF), are now open.

Registration fee is Rs 999 plus GST for adults, and Rs 850 plus GST for children. Last date to register is September 24.

Participants can choose from several running, cycling, and kids’ categories. Adults can run distances from 3 km to 25 km, while cycling events range from 10 km to 125 km. Children aged 4-17 years can take part in races from 400 m to 10 km. Participants will receive a finisher t-shirt, BIB, medal, e-certificate, e-badge and refreshments.

The route will begin at Anna University and cover city roads and stretches of the East Coast Road.

The event is organised by Neville Jamshed Bilimoria, a national silver medallist in rowing who has completed 63 marathons worldwide, and is a Super Randonneur for 13 consecutive years. Proceeds from the marathon will support underprivileged children through education and medical care, and contribute to cancer treatment at the Adyar Cancer Institute (WIA).
